Demystifying Interstitial Ads: Types and Best Practices

Interstitial ads are a common type of online advertising that appear in between content on a website or app. These full-screen ads often appear when users navigate to a new page or complete a step. While some users may find them annoying, interstitial ads can be effective for boosting revenue and raising brand recognition. To maximize their impact, it's essential to understand the different types of interstitial ads and follow best practices for implementation.

  • Several common types of interstitial ads include:
  • App install interstitials
  • In-app purchase interstitials
  • Sponsored content interstitials

When implementing interstitial ads, consider the following best practices:

  • Keep them concise and to the point.
  • Incorporate high-quality visuals and compelling messaging.
  • Offer a clear call to action.
  • Refrain from interrupting user flow too frequently.

Interstitial Ads Explained: A Comprehensive Guide

Interstitial ads are a common form of online here advertising that appear in between content of websites or apps. They typically take up the entire screen and display a message before users can proceed to the next part of their experience. These ads are often full-screen and designed to be eye-catching.

  • Often, interstitial ads are presented when a user completes a task within an app or website.
  • Moreover, they may also appear at specific times.
  • A number of businesses employ interstitial ads to increase brand awareness.

Understanding how interstitial ads work and their potential impact is essential for both website owners and users.
